Submission is a two-step process requiring: 1) a pre-application submission, and 2) for those who are invited, a full application submission. Pre-applications do not need to be submitted to the Office of Research, only full applications.  Please select "Angela Vuk" when asked for the Business Official name on your Pre-application.

Pre-applications must be submitted through eBRAP and full applications must be submitted through Grants.gov.   Both require pre-registration by the PI. Refer to the General Application Instructions, Section II.A. for registration and submission requirements for eBRAP and Grants.gov. 

 ​eBRAP is a multifunctional web-based system that allows PIs to submit their pre-applications electronically through a secure connection, to view and edit the content of their pre-applications and full applications, to receive communications from the CDMRP, and to submit documentation during award negotiations and period of performance.  A key feature of eBRAP is the ability of an organization’s representatives and PIs to view and modify the Grants.gov application submissions associated with them.  eBRAP will validate Grants.gov application files against the specific Program Announcement/Funding Opportunity requirements and discrepancies will be noted in an email to the PI and in the Full Application Files tab in eBRAP.  It is the applicant’s responsibility to review all application components for accuracy as well as ensure proper ordering as specified in this Program Announcement/Funding Opportunity.  Please note that Grants.gov validation of your full application may take up to 72 hours and this must be taken into account when working towards the DoD external deadline.  No extensions are granted if the application is still in the validation process.
